Abstract

The phase relationships in the La–Ni–Si ternary system at 673 K were investigated by X-ray diffraction (XRD), differential thermal analysis (DTA), scanning electron microscopy (SEM) and electron probe microanalysis (EPMA). All phase relationships were studied at 673 K. At this temperature, the existence of 14 ternary compounds has been confirmed. This section consists of 35 single-phase regions, 78 two-phase regions, and 47 three-phase regions. At 673 K, the maximum solid solubility of Si in Ni, La2Ni7, LaNi5, and La2NiSi is about 9, 3, 8.33, and 5 at.%, respectively. Several ternary compounds form a homogeneity region which can be expressed as LaNi11.6–9.5Si1.4–3.5, LaNi8.8–8.4Si4.2–4.6, and LaNi7.8–6.5Si5.2–6.5. [Copyright &y& Elsevier]
